ALDI is a phenomenon in consumer retailing - some would say a miracle. Often compared to Wal-Mart and General Electric, the inner workings and factors driving the success of this retail giant are revealed in this book by a former ALDI executive. For ALDI, success comes from being different. ALDI is distinctive, with a corporate culture, philosophy, working principles and organisational methods that have brought significant growth and success. ALDI believes that this difference is what makes for success in the long term – and has seen the company growing profitably for over 50 years. What is it that ALDI has done – and continues to do – so differently, and what are the implications of this approach for other companies and industries? In this book, Dieter Brandes examines the inner-workings of ALDI and how it became such a retailing force. On September 21, 1992, the Development Committee, a joint ministerial committee of the Boards of Governors of the World Bank and the International Monetary Fund issued a set of universal guidelines on the legal treatment of foreign investment and called those Guidelines to the attention of the members of these institutions. The text of the guidelines was prepared by a small working group chaired by Ibrahim Shihata, the World Bank's Vice President and General Counsel. According to Mr. Shihata, the success of this endeavour was "the product of changing realities and perceptions about foreign investment and the benefits it can bring to global economy and the economies of developing countries in particular. In a broader sense, the great transformations of the late 80s and early 90s created a new environment which made possible agreement on many issues thought earlier to defy common solutions. " This book provides a record and a personal account of the author of the steps which led to the issue, by the Development Committee, of the Guidelines on the Treatment of Foreign Investment, and a first hand explanation of the text of the Guidelines (which is published in the book in three languages). The book also contains the studies which preceded the preparations of that text and the official reports which explain its rationale and contents. The book may therefore be read as a complement to the author's earlier book on "MIGA and Foreign Investment" (1988). Together, the two books provide detailed accounts of the continued efforts by the World Bank to encourage the flow of international investments through specific mechanisms which complement its financing, catalytic and advisory roles in pursuance of one of its main purposes, which is "to promote foreign private investment. Multinational enterprises (MNEs) invest in a variety of host economies, and closely interact with local businesses and society at large. This role has become the focus of policy debates of all sorts, as MNEs are seen as a primary conduit of globalization, thus spreading both its benefits and its negative side effects. This selection offers an interdisciplinary perspective on MNEs and host economies. Theoretical models are provided by economics research, yet some of the more subtle and complex forms of impact are hard to analyse using economics methodologies. A range of other disciplines such as management, sociology and ethics thus contribute to the discussion of these wider issues. The articles in this collection cover theoretical and empirical studies on the horizontal and vertical impact on local firms, to issues of labour standards and the natural environment, and normative issues.
